Safety informationTo supply RLM 01, use only a safety-low voltage. This requirement also applies to
the alarm contact supply.
In accordance with the UL/CSA requirements an external protection (e.g. fuse) is
prescribed. The fuse rating can amounted to 1.6A to 10A (characteristic: medium
slow-acting or slow-acting). Protection of groups of several devices with a common
fuse is admissible (several RLM 01 or RLM 01 together with other devices).
When selecting a mounting location, make certain that the limit values for ambient
conditions specified in the technical data are observed and the module can discharge
heat without any obstruction.
Do not connect any bus lines that are laid partially or entirely outside buildings.
Voltage overload, for example resulting from lightning strikes, may destroy the
module. For protection against cases such as these, use optical fibre cable and
appropriate medium converters (electrical <==> optical) as high-quality electrical
isolation.
In accordance with the PROFIBUS installation guideline the shielding of the bus
cables are preferably connected at the start and at the end with earth potential. Place
the module on a low-resistance and low-inductance earthed DIN mounting rail.
Grounding measures by way of the E terminal (1) on the terminal strip are then not
required.
Front panel elements
Three Sub-D connectors A, B and M are located on the front panel of the RLM 01
for connection of the PROFIBUS cable. The 8-pin male multi-pin connector with
the associated terminal strip is used to connect the alarm and power supply wires.
There are also LEDs for activity/error display, a rotary switch for setting the
transmission rate and a reset button (activate transmission rate).

The redundant PROFIBUS lines are connected to the two terminals A and B.
Terminal M is provided for the non-redundant PROFIBUS line. All three
PROFIBUS connections A, B and M are designed uniformly with 9-pin Sub-D
connectors (sockets). The pin assignment conforms to the PROFIBUS standard.
RLM 01 uses only pins 3+8 for data transfer and 6+5 for power supply to an
external resistor combination for bus termination. The following table shows the
maximum assignment for PROFIBUS usage.
